Opinion

MICKLE, Judge.

We affirm the convictions and sentences in this appeal, which was brought pursuant to Anders v. California, 386 U.S. 738, 87 S.Ct. 1396, 18 L.Ed.2d 493 (1967). However, we remand for correction of the written judgment form which incorrectly designates the offense of battery (Count I) as a first-degree felony when, in fact, it is a first-degree misdemeanor. Section 784.03(2), Florida Statutes (1993).

ERVIN and LAWRENCE, JJ., concur.
